Arthur Henry William SHILTON

SHILTON, Arthur Henry William

Service Number: 500
Last Rank: Private
Last Unit: 21st Infantry Battalion
Home Town: Footscray, Maribyrnong, Victoria
Died: Illness (Pneumonia), At sea (HMAT Ulysses), At sea (HMAT Ulysses A38), 30 May 1915, age not yet discovered
Cemetery: No known grave - "Known Unto God"
Buried at Sea, Chatby Memorial, Alexandria, Egypt
Memorials: Australian War Memorial Roll of Honour, Chatby Memorial, Alexandria, Egypt
